TM/16/01753/FL - The Nursery, Taylors Lane, Trottiscliffe pdf icon PDF 117 KB

Additional documents:

Minutes:

Permanent retention of a static mobile home as accommodation for an agricultural worker ancillary to the nursery business and retention of 2no. dog kennels and pens at The Nursery, Taylors Lane, Trottiscliffe.

 

RESOLVED:  That planning permission be GRANTED in accordance with the submitted details, conditions, reasons and informatives set out in the report of the Director of Planning, Housing and Environmental Health; subject to

 

(1)     Amended Conditions:

 

1.     The occupation of the static mobile home shall be limited to:

 

-        A person solely or mainly employed in the associated Nursery business or a widow (or widower) of such a person;

-        A dependant living within the household of such a person referred to above

 

Reason: The occupation of the static mobile home by persons not associated with Nursery business would result in a separation of functions and expansion of movements and paraphernalia that could harm the openness of the Green Belt and character and visual amenity of the rural area.

 

2.     The residential use hereby permitted shall cease within 1 month of the date that the horticultural enterprise at The Nursery no longer has an essential requirement for permanent on site presence.  The caravan and any structures, materials and equipment brought on to, or erected on the land, or works undertaken to it in connection with the residential use (including the dog pens and kennels) shall be removed and the land restored to its condition before the development took place in accordance with a scheme previously submitted to and approved by the Local Planning Authority.

 

Reason: To preserve the openness of the Green Belt and ensure that the character and visual amenity of the rural locality is not significantly harmed.

 

3.     No replacement caravan shall be stationed on the site except in accordance with details that have been submitted to and approved by the Local Planning Authority in respect of its size and appearance.

 

Reason:  To preserve the openness of the Green Belt and ensure that the character and visual amenity of the rural locality is not significantly harmed.

 

4.     The static mobile home hereby approved shall only be stationed in the position shown on Drawing No. 1786/18A Rev 04/11 hereby approved and no additional caravan shall be stationed on the site at any time.  The extent of the garden amenity area shall be limited to the area indicated on Drawing No. 1786/18A Rev 04/11 comprising 14m by 33m

 

Reason:  To preserve the openness of the Green Belt and ensure that the character and visual amenity of the rural locality is not significantly harmed.

 

[Speaker: Richard Wallis – Trottiscliffe Parish Council]

TM/17/01392/RM - Area 1, Kings Hill Phase 3, Gibson Drive, Kings Hill pdf icon PDF 798 KB

Additional documents:

Minutes:

Reserved matters for 132 dwellings in Area 1 (junction of Tower View and Kings Hill Avenue) being details relating to the siting, design and external appearance of the proposed buildings, the means of access, drainage and strategic landscaping involving discharge of conditions 1, 12, 13, 19, 20, 23, 37, 38 and 39 of TM/13/01535/OAEA (Outline planning permission for residential development) at

Area 1, Kings Hill Phase 3, Gibson Drive, Kings Hill.

 

RESOLVED:  That Reserved Matters be DEFERRED for the following:

 

-        Further clarity on traffic movements generated by the Housing Area

-        Further consideration of the location of the play area

-        Further consideration of the impacts of having a single access point

 

Reason:  To protect and enhance the appearance and character of the site and locality and in the interests of residential amenity.

 

[Speakers:  Caroline Bridger, Kings Hill Parish Council and Matthew Woodhead, agent]
